  • Patent number: 8388895
    Abstract: In an apparatus for producing U3O8 powder, the apparatus has an oxidation reactor including an interior space, a scrap box loaded with UO2 sintered pellets to be oxidized and introduced into the interior space of the oxidation reactor, an impact generating unit applying an impact to the scrap box to dissipate heat generated by the oxidation of the UO2 sintered pellets in the oxidation reactor, and a control unit controlling an oxidation process. The apparatus for producing U3O8 powder allows the heat generated by the oxidation of the UO2 sintered pellets in the oxidation reactor to be uniformly dissipated by the impact generating unit, thus producing U3O8 powder having a larger specific surface area which can be used to obtain a sintered UO2 pellet with a larger and more stable grain size of increased quality.

  • Patent number: 6392554
    Abstract: An electromagnetic wave isolation apparatus is provided for use in household multi-outlets, which apparatus includes an electromagnetic wave detecting circuit for sensing induced electromagnetic waves generated in the home or office and generating an output signal responsive to a predetermined level of the induced electromagnetic waves. An electromagnetic wave isolation circuit is provided, in response to the output signal of the detecting circuit to generate an output signal for driving a lamp which indicates the presence of electromagnetic waves and subsequently for driving a switch which enables one of AC output lines to be connected with the circuitry ground of the multi-outlet. A switching circuit is also included for activating a second switch provided in each of the AC output lines in response to the output signal of the isolation circuit. A resistor is connected between the circuitry ground and the ground terminal of the power cord of the multi-outlet.
